What is Revenue Cycle Management?

Revenue Cycle Management is the process by which healthcare facilities manage the administrative and clinical functions associated with claims processing, payment, and revenue generation. RCM encompasses the entire lifecycle of a patient account, from initial appointment scheduling and insurance verification to billing and collections. Efficient RCM processes are vital for ensuring timely payments and minimizing errors, which can lead to increased profitability.

Key Components of Revenue Cycle Management

  1. Patient Registration and Scheduling: Accurate patient information collection is the first step in RCM. Proper scheduling and registration ensure that eligibility and benefits verification are conducted seamlessly, reducing claims rejections.

  2. Insurance Verification and Authorization: Verifying insurance details and obtaining necessary pre-authorizations can prevent claim denials. This step is critical for ensuring services are covered and reimbursed appropriately.

  3. Coding and Charge Capture: Accurate medical coding and charge capturing are essential for correct billing. Errors in this phase can lead to denied claims or revenue loss.

  4. Claims Submission and Management: Efficient claims submission and proactive management help in reducing turnaround times for payments. Automated systems can enhance accuracy and speed up this process.

  5. Payment Posting and Reconciliation: Recording payments accurately and reconciling them ensures that records are up-to-date and discrepancies are addressed promptly.

  6. Denial Management: Implementing a robust denial management system helps in identifying patterns and correcting issues that lead to denied claims, thereby improving cash flow.

  7. Patient Collections: Effective strategies for managing out-of-pocket payments from patients can significantly boost the revenue stream.

Benefits of Revenue Cycle Management

Improved Cash Flow

By streamlining the billing process and reducing errors, RCM ensures faster payments, leading to improved cash flow. This allows healthcare providers to reinvest in their services and technologies.

Enhanced Patient Experience

Efficient RCM processes result in quicker, more transparent billing practices, enhancing the patient experience. This can lead to higher patient satisfaction and retention rates.

Reduced Administrative Costs

Automating various RCM tasks reduces the administrative burden on healthcare staff, allowing them to focus more on patient care. This reduction in workload lowers operational costs, contributing to higher profitability.

Increased Revenue

By minimizing claim denials and ensuring accurate billing, healthcare providers can capture more revenue. Effective RCM practices can lead to a substantial increase in overall profitability.

Strategies for Enhancing Profitability with RCM

  1. Invest in Technology: Adopting advanced RCM software solutions can automate mundane tasks, reducing errors and speeding up processes.

  2. Staff Training: Regular training for staff on the latest RCM practices and compliance requirements can ensure high efficiency and accuracy.

  3. Data Analytics: Utilizing data analytics can help in understanding trends and identifying areas for improvement within the RCM process.

  4. Outsource RCM Services: Partnering with a specialized RCM service provider can bring in expertise and help manage complex billing environments more effectively.
